ORDER

The petitioner filed this Writ Petition seeking to quash the impugned order dated 19.07.2016, passed by the first respondent in proceedings R.C.No.PEN/EZ/141/11236/2016.

2. The learned counsel for the petitioner submitted that the petitioner passed away in the year 2017.

3. In view of the above, this Writ Petition stands dismissed as abated. No costs. Consequently, all connected miscellaneous petitions are closed K.SURENDER, J.
